Nan - if done right, yes! The events are not to sell; that is not the purpose. If that is your purpose, you are wasting your time. Events are to find alliances, people targeting the same audience. Then work with them with resources and ways to enhance THEIR business. When you show your true colors, then the relationship grows into Word of Mouth. Word of Mouth is the most effective way to sell your product/service. It is built upon relationships that don't just happen at a networking event. It comes from a dedication to people who could be an alliance. Networking is what you GIVE, not what you get. Then it become profitable.
